Talisayen Cove in Zambales is part of the island hopping which includes Camara Island, Capones Island, Nagsasa Cove and Anawangin Cove. Talisayen Cove is beautiful and really quiet and it will be a great stop for spending 1-2 hours there or even staying overnight.

HOW TO GET TO TALISAYEN COVE

If you want to get to Talisayen Cove. First you will have to get to Pundaquit in Zambales. There are buses from Victory Liner from Manila it takes 4 hours via Olongapo and the rate is 270 PHP. There are buses from Olongapo to San Antonio in Zambales 40 minutes and the fare is 55 PHP.

There are buses from DAU bus terminal in Angeles City to Olongapo City 150 PHP and it takes almost 2 hours. There are also vans going to Olongapo from DAU bus terminal it takes 1 hour and 30 minutes and the rate is 130 PHP. This is the way that we took from Angeles City in Pampanga.

If you want to reach San Antonio by tricycle from the Bus Terminal it is 30 PHP per person to Pundaquit and vice-versa and a minimum of 60 PHP per tricycle. In Pundaquit you can get a boat for your island hopping going to Talisayen Cove and more islands.

TALISAYEN COVE

Talisayen Cove is quiet and probably least visited of the mentioned island in the island hopping in Zambales. To reach Talisayen Cove from Pundaquit beach, it will cost you 2000 PHP and 2500 PHP if you add more destinations like Capones, Camara Island, Nagsasa Cove and Anawangin Cove.

There is no electricity and phone signal in the island! You can pitch your tent or renting for 400-500 PHP. We advice to bring your own tent since it costs 1000 PHP will be better option than renting and you can use for future trips!

Talisayen Cove entrance fee is 50 PHP and 100 PHP if you are staying overnight with the tent. There are cottages for renting too.

BEST TIME FOR VISITING TALISAYEN COVE

If you’re traveling to Zambales the warmest months here are April and May. Basically, January to March is the best time to visit Zambales as this is the sunniest period of the year and is relatively cooler than other months.

WHERE TO STAY AT TALISAYEN COVE ZAMBALES

Sleeping in a tent in Talisayen Cove can cost 500 PHP for renting a tent and the islands usually have a fee for staying overnight. It’s usually 100-150 PHP per person. For renting a cottage 350 PHP during the day and 750 PHP if you stay overnight.
